Councillors agree to fund Belfast St Patrick’s Day event

Belfast City Council has agreed to fund this year's Saint Patrick's Day celebrations, despite objections to the move by the Democratic Unionist Party.

Councillors voted by 25 to 24 last night to provide £100,000 (€145,100) towards the carnival-type event, which is planned for Customs House Square on March 17.
